This document summarizes a technical seminar presentation on augmented reality. The presentation introduces augmented reality, how it works by superimposing digital images onto the real world using smartphones. It covers the history and development of augmented reality, from early prototypes in the 1960s to current medical, entertainment, advertising, and other applications. Implementation requires tracking user location and orientation to generate and augment data to their view. While augmented reality is growing, challenges remain around accurate tracking, limited computing power, and size of systems.
